Ticket #—locked vault blocking weather-alert fan-out

The Stormgrove fan-out service can't publish alerts to third-party plugins because its credentials vault re-locked after last night's host reboot. Plugin authors: expect delayed test alerts until this clears. Unlocking requires the on-call engineer to enter the vault recovery passphrase, reproduced below for the duration of this incident.

recovery phrase for bawep-kawef: oliath-casdor

Break-Glass Access: Currency Rounding Incidents. Support team: if customers report off-by-a-cent totals from the Marrowfield conversion service, escalation may require break-glass access to the ledger console to inspect raw rates. Use this only after two confirmed reports, log the incident first, then authenticate at the console with the recovery passphrase below.

recovery phrase for fajep-yaweg: gilath-sorox-wenius-rusdor-keliel-zorius

Currency conversion rounding errors resurfaced on the Tollgate checkout flow at 02:10. Investigation shows the converter fell back to a stale rate table because its credential to the internal Ratesmith service expired, and the fallback rounds to two decimals before multiplication. Fix: rotate the credential, restart the converter pods, verify drift alarms clear. Rollback not needed; data is recoverable from the ledger replay. The replacement key for the Ratesmith service is below.

API key for tagug-tajef: vxb4-R1fo